Programme Descriptions:

The dishwasher offers five distinct programmes, each designed for different cleaning needs:

  1. Eco 50°: This programme is an energy-efficient option for normally soiled dishes. It has a duration of 4 hours, consumes 11.5 litres of water, and uses 0.83 kWh of energy. It includes a drying phase and requires detergent in both the tub and dispenser B.

  2. Intensive 65°: Ideal for heavily soiled dishes, this programme runs for 2 hours and 30 minutes. It consumes 15.0 litres of water and 1.5 kWh of energy. It also includes a drying phase and requires detergent in both the tub and dispenser B.

  3. Normal 55°: A standard programme for everyday use, lasting 2 hours and 25 minutes. It uses 15.0 litres of water and 1.35 kWh of energy. This programme includes a drying phase and requires detergent in both the tub and dispenser B.

  4. Rapid 40' 50°: A quick wash option for lightly soiled dishes, completing in just 40 minutes. It consumes 8.0 litres of water and 0.9 kWh of energy. This programme does not include a drying phase and requires detergent only in dispenser B.

  5. Half Load 50°: Designed for smaller loads, this programme runs for 1 hour and 15 minutes. It uses 11.0 litres of water and 0.9 kWh of energy. It includes a drying phase and requires detergent in both the tub and dispenser B.

Usage Features:

Starting the Dishwasher:

  1. Load the dishwasher: Arrange dishes properly to ensure effective cleaning.
  2. Check arm rotation: Ensure the upper and lower spray arms can rotate freely without obstruction from dishes.
  3. Add detergent: Place the appropriate amount of detergent into the designated compartments (tub and/or dispenser B) according to the selected programme.
  4. Switch on: Press the ON/OFF button to power on the appliance.
  5. Select programme: Use the programme selection button to choose the desired washing cycle.
  6. Start programme: Press the START/Pause button and then close the dishwasher door to begin the cycle.

Unloading the Dishwasher:

  • Safety warning: Do not open the dishwasher door while the appliance is in operation.
  • Steam caution: Exercise care when opening the door after a cycle, as hot steam will escape.
  • Cooling period: Allow dishes to cool for 15-30 minutes before unloading. This prevents burns and helps dishes dry more effectively.
  • Unloading order: Always unload the lower rack first, followed by the upper rack. This prevents any residual water from the upper rack from dripping onto the dry dishes below.
